Oracle Reports Strong Cloud Revenue Growth

Oracle Corp. reported FQ1 2026 revenue of $14.9 billion, up 11% year-over-year, driven by cloud services including $7.2 billion total cloud revenue (+27%) and $3.3 billion cloud infrastructure (+54%). The company said RPO rose 359% to $455 billion, and highlighted strong growth in Cloud Database Services, Autonomous Database, and multi-cloud database revenue. On Dec. 4, Citi lowered its price target to $375 from $415 but maintained a Buy rating.
